Launched in 2009 as a jewel in the exclusive “La Collection Privée Christian Dior,” Ambre Nuit was an immediate statement. This was not a fragrance designed for the fleeting trends of the mass market. Instead, it was a testament to the art of perfumery, a return to olfactory storytelling. The collection itself was a curated library of scents built from the finest raw materials, each telling a distinct story connected to the heritage of the house of Dior. Ambre Nuit found its place as the sensual, enigmatic oriental, a scent that played with the duality of light and shadow, strength and tenderness.
The inspiration, as envisioned by Dior, is a tale as old as time: the meeting of Beauty and the Beast. It’s a theme rooted in the opulent, baroque balls of the 18th century—a world of velvet, intrigue, and whispered secrets. Perfumer François Demachy orchestrated this encounter, pairing the delicate, velvety Turkish rose with the deep, animalic warmth of ambergris. The result is a fragrance built on a tension that is utterly magnetic. It's the contrast between the classic, romantic floral and the raw, carnal base that gives Ambre Nuit its profound, elusive character. The Nose Behind the Scent
François Demachy, the esteemed in-house Perfumer-Creator for Dior from 2006 to 2021. Raised in Grasse, he is the nose behind modern classics like Dior Sauvage, the Dior Homme line, and the entire Maison Christian Dior collection.

Scent Journey
A luminous and brief opening of juicy grapefruit and bergamot, immediately spiced with a vibrant dash of pink pepper. It's a bright, inviting prelude to the warmth that follows.
The heart emerges as a breathtaking duet between a rich, velvety Turkish rose and a warm, salty ambergris. This is the core of the fragrance, a perfectly balanced, romantic, and sensual dance that feels both elegant and intimate.
A long and luxurious drydown where the ambergris glows, becoming a warm, slightly powdery, and endlessly comforting skin scent. The rose softens to a whisper, supported by creamy woods and a clean patchouli, leaving a final impression of pure sophistication.
Performance Dashboard
Excellent longevity, easily lasting 8-10 hours on skin and lingering on clothes for days.
Projects moderately for the first 2-3 hours, creating a noticeable and elegant aura without being overpowering.
Leaves a beautiful, alluring trail that is perceptible to others but remains refined and sophisticated.

📜 Reformulation History
While no major, official reformulations have been confirmed, some enthusiasts note subtle differences in potency between the original 'La Collection Privée' bottles and the current 'Maison Christian Dior' line. However, the core character of the fragrance is widely considered to be intact.
